Malloc linked list in c
Web9 apr. 2024 · 1 Answer. ht->list [i] is an array element. The array ht->list was allocated dynamically, but the addresses of its individual elements were not, so you can't free them. The dynamically-allocated elements are in the linked list reached from ht->list [i].head, and you freed them in the while loop. The "use after free" is because &ht->list [0] is ... Web26 mrt. 2024 · Operations carried out under stack in C programming language are as follows − Push Pop Push Following is the basic implementation of a linked list − &item = 10 newnode = (node*) malloc (sizeof (node)); newnode ->data = item; newnode ->link = NULL; newnode ->link = start; start = newnode; pop The syntax is as follows − Syntax
Malloc linked list in c
Did you know?
WebWe will look at two different methods –. Method 1: Uses additional size variable to keep track of Linked List Size. Method 2: No additional variable, we calculate the size in realtime. Method 1. Method 2. Run. #include #include struct Node { int data; struct Node *next; }; int size = 0; void insertMiddle (struct Node **head ... http://duoduokou.com/c/62081746641462781012.html
WebC 从用户处获取输入并打印的链接列表,c,linked-list,malloc,C,Linked List,Malloc,我正在尝试用c编写一个程序,从用户那里获取输入(chars)。 用户应该能够输入他想要的任何内容(“无限”) 这是我最终编写的程序,没有任何错误: 代码: /* main: we will try to get an input from the user. if we succeed, call insert function. Web23 jul. 2024 · Linked List Using Double Pointers. For the current example, nodes are dynamically allocated (using malloc()) and each node consists of a data field and a reference (a pointer) to the next node in the list. In the case of the last node in the list, the next field contains NULL - it is set as a null pointer. Our nodes are defined with a C struct ...
WebAdding to a C Linked List with malloc - Creating a linked list of Easter Eggs using a C structure to represent each Easter Egg. The list starts out pointing... WebApproach to solving the question: To implement the convert_to_base_n function, we need to take the input number (which is stored in a linked list) and convert it to the output base specified as an input argument. Here's an approach we could take to solve this problem: Check if the output base is valid (i.e., between 2 and 16).
WebA linked list is a linear data structure that includes a series of connected nodes. Here, each node stores the data and the address of the next node. For example, Linked list …
WebThe most commonly used linked list is Malloc and Free (), let's take a brief introduction. Apply for storage space functions malloc Malloc function original void *malloc(unsigned int size); Its function is to apply for a continuous storage space for a length Size byte in the dynamic storage area of the memory. And return ... chomp awayWebIn C programming Language, a LinkedList is a data structure consisting of nodes, nodes are connected using address. LinkedList is the most used Data Structure after the array, in … chomp authorWeb28 jun. 2024 · C/C++ Program The Great Tree-List Recursion Problem. C/C++ Program to Copy a linked list with next and arbit pointer. C/C++ Program for Given a linked list … grazebrook primary school n16WebLinked List Program in C - A linked list is a sequence of data structures, which are connected together via links. Linked List is a sequence of links which contains items. … grazebrook primary hackneyWebC 线程1接收到信号SIGSEGV,分段故障,c,linked-list,segmentation-fault,queue,malloc,C,Linked List,Segmentation Fault,Queue,Malloc,我试着用gdb调试 … grazebrook primary school hackneyWebFor creating a linked list, we’ll define the structure of our linked list (using the structdata type), which will represent what a single node in a linked list will look like. And then we’ll actually create a linked list by assigning memory to use using the malloc()function. Structure of a linked list: chompa spidermanWeb14 apr. 2024 · Step1: Check for the node to be NULL, if yes then return -1 and terminate the process, else go to step 2. Step2: Declare a temporary node and store the pointer to the head node. Step3: Now, shift the pointer to the current head stack to the next stack in the linked list. Step4: Store the data of the current node and then delete the node. graze bridgnorth website